Lien enforcement can be a complex process that is best handled by an experienced creditor attorney. Attempting foreclosure or lien enforcement without help can result in errors such as:
- Wage garnishment in violation of notice provisions
- Default judgments that violate due process or jurisdictional protections
- Debtor denying proper service of process
- Failure to follow proper procedures in mortgage foreclosures
- Failure to make proper disclosures
Debtors may be able to use these types of claims as a defense in collections and enforcement cases. Making an error or not following the statutes can also result in counterclaims for damages filed by the debtor.
